Description
The Pectinatus spp. real-time qPCR detection kit from Primerdesign provides detection of Pectinatus, strictly anaerobic spoilage bacteria that cause turbidity and strong sulphurous off-odours in fermentation and beverage production. The TaqMan-based assay targets a conserved region of the genus for sensitive detection directly from extracted DNA, enabling early quality-control intervention without slow anaerobic culture.
Each kit supplies a ready-to-use primer and probe mix together with a positive control template, providing a complete workflow from extracted DNA on any standard real-time PCR platform. The Advanced format additionally includes an internal extraction control to flag inhibition and a copy-number standard curve for absolute quantification of the target sequence.

It is suited to fermentation, beverage and industrial quality control and process hygiene. Available in Standard (qualitative) and Advanced (quantitative) formats, with detailed set-up and result interpretation described in the included IFU/handbook.
